Perhaps this will help  Dial Drive Rebuilding – Models 116, 640, 643, 645, 650, 651, 655, 660, 665 – Philco Library (philcoradio.com) Some set screws can be tough to remove. A good fitting screwdriver is a must with straight blade not rounded on the corners. You can try holding a hot soldering tip on the offending screw. I'm pretty sure that the part is mostly pot metal so if you want to use a torch be careful not to melt it.
